Linux 发行版本下terminal字体设置

       使用oh-my-zsh时,用到它的主题很漂亮,但是需要字体的支持,但是要想在终端上显示,需要终端字体设置为支持该主题用到的字体。

       从github上下载字体后,安装到系统上,终端模拟器上设置字体的部分,列表里仍然没有手动安装后的字体,这也就意味着无法设置该字体。那么oh-my-zsh主题在终端上显示不出来某些字符。

       无论怎么操作,terminal(kconsole或gnome-terminal)中都不会有 自己安装的字体。(如最下面所述,推测如果该字体原始为等宽【monospace】的,应该会显示!)

       但是将下载的.ttf后缀的字体放到”用户家目录下的‘.fonts’文件夹下“,然后注销(或重启),重新登录后,打开终端发现该字体被默认应用了。(但是也会有点小问题,如图标会变小(个人遇到的))

       网上说的’mkfontdir’,'mkfontscale','fc-cache -fv'(也有一种'fc-cache -fv ~/.fonts')的命令不知道是否必须。

注意:

        .fonts目录如果没有,则自己创建一个就行。

============================================================================

       对于gnome-terminal或kconsole,无论是将自己需要的字体放在~/.fonts、~/.local/share/fonts、还是/usr/share/fonts目录下,然后执行fc-cache -fv命令,gnome-terminal或kconsole自定义字体,展示出的字体列表仍然不会出现该字体。

       google上有一种解决方案完美解决了这个问题:

       安装“tweaks”应用,然后操作如下图:

       还有一点google上没有说明:这里 设置完毕后,在gnome-terminal中,不要在勾选使用“自定义字体”了。terminal会自动使用该处设定的字体。

注意:要想该处有自己安装的字体,需要将.ttf的字体文件放置到用户家目录下的.fonts中。

转载于:https://my.oschina.net/u/3015386/blog/1941395

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值